Senior Product Engineer- Application Life Cycle Specialist

The Boeing Company is seeking a Senior Product Engineer- Application Life Cycle Specialist (Level 4) to join our team in Plano, Texas or Long Beach, California to support AvionX Engineering and Process & Tools activities.

Boeing AvionX develops and produces avionics and electronics systems designed for use on aircraft and other platforms for purposes such as navigation, flight controls, information systems, and other core avionics functions. We are innovating and developing new products to address the future of the urban air mobility as well as our next generation of commercial, tactical, and trainer aircraft markets.

Position Responsibilities:

  • Focal for the development and implementation of complex engineering initiatives, including rollout of major engineering and software tools, lean and quality projects, and key Process & Tools priorities.
  • Responsible for the planning, road-mapping, resource identification, and execution of Application Lifecycle Management (ALM) tools and software packages.
  • Serve as the primary liaison to AvionX Product Lines to elicit, document, and validate system and tool requirements
  • Translate Product Line requirements into actionable solution specifications and clear acceptance criteria for engineering and IT implementation teams
  • Collaborate closely with the IT organization to align Product Line priorities with enterprise roadmaps, resource capacity, and governance processes; jointly develop prioritization frameworks
  • Responsible for the strategic management of our tool deployments, cutovers, sunsetting activities, acceptance testing, and adoption plans for AvionX Product Lines
  • Identifies technology needs from a hardware, software, and cloud computing perspective in conjunction with key leaders
  • Develops concise and pointed engineering presentations to drive communication and execution of AvionX Engineering goals and priorities.
  • Maintain and provide detailed engineering metrics and KPI's on all associated projects.
  • Proposes new projects and initiatives based on findings and experience within the organization.
